Find hidden partition dell inspiron 1501

Hi, you were right. There is a hidden partition for recovery purposes when your computer has OEM OS. You can see it by using partition tools such partition wizard home edition and you can download it for free. After you run this program you will see a recovery partition which is hidden from your sight. Hope this will answer your question.

My laptop inspiron 1501 says ntldr missing

Hi ... The 'NTLDR missing' means that windows NT Loder file is missing so OS can't boot.1- Check that you haven't any usb key or something like connected to ur laptop.2- Make an update to ur OS by using installation CD and choose update option to re install NTLDR file.About BIOS password you must remember pass or who make it to solve this problem.I hope this can help you ;)

My computer is down because of malware and i cannot use it. Please help

Listen, Jennie, the best route for you is to simply reinstall the software that came with your Dell or use the backup disks that you were advised to make. Assuming you made them, all you have to do is go into your bios and make sure that your optical drive (cd or dvd) drive is set as the first boot up device. Then pop in the disk and follow the prompts. If you did not make the disks or have any Dell disks you may be able to get the software from Dell directly. OR check among your peers to see who has an XP OS install disk. Use that to install the operating system and then download the necessary drivers from Dell site. http://www.dell.com/support/home/us/en/19/product-support/product/inspiron-1501/drivers Whatever you do, resist the impulse to install an OS other than XP - the latter will work best with your machine. NEWER is not better! Good luck.

I have a dell involve laptop while i was trying to set back to factory specks i got locked out and it wont let me access any thing with out my administrator password and i don't no it what can i do to

No laptop is trashed when a password is lost. It just takes a little time to find out how to get into the system. I'll assume it is running XP Home that was originally installed on it from the specs I saw when researching. I'll also assume the password is not the one necessary to get into the BIOS CMOS setup- that one can normally be cleared by removing the CMOS battery and letting it set for a few hours or longer so the information is lost. The OS password can be cleared by making a bootable disk for that purpose. I have a Unix CD program that I made from information I downloaded from the Internet. You can do the same if you have access to a CD burner on another computer, say a friend's or one at work. I can get you the program's name if that's the route you want to take.

Dell Inspiron 1501 Notebook bios password reset

There is a bios battery on the laptop that needs to be removed for about 10 seconds. You have to essentially disassemble the laptop in order to access it.

What does no boot device found mean

It means there it is not finding an operating system ie: Windows. If it was working before it may be as simple as you have a cd in the drive it's trying to read or your hard drive has failed and you will need a new hard drive and will have to reinstall Windows.
